Governor Sokoto To Sale 300 Trucks Of Rice At Subsidized Rate

By Muhammad Ibrahim, Sokoto

In line with one of the governor Ahmad Aliyu’s nine points agenda, the Sokoto State government is to purchase 300 trucks of rice to sell at subsidized rates across the state.

The state commissioner for local government and chieftaincy affairs, Ibrahim Dadi Adare, made the disclosure while briefing newsmen on the outcome of the 6th state exco meeting of the year presided over by Governor Ahmed Aliyu at the council.

The meeting steered today by governor Ahmad Aliyu has in attendance all the executive council members.
